Norway's Constitution Day: A Celebration of Tradition and National Identity On May 17th, Norway celebrates its Constitution Day, a significant event marked by parades, festivities, and the wearing of traditional clothing called bunads. This year, the celebration took on a personal dimension for influencer Leah Maríe (@ladyleahmarie), who shared her experience trying on her mother's bunad for the first time. In a short video, Maríe explains the significance of the bunad, noting that each design represents a specific region of Norway. "Each bunad is designed to represent a specific region of Norway," she says, highlighting the cultural importance of the garment. She also describes the celebratory atmosphere, mentioning champagne breakfasts and gatherings with friends.
